2026 PFN Player Previews: Jaden Greenblatt-WR/DB-Punxsutawney

Tagged under: District 9, News, Player Previews

| July 5, 2026


Jaden Greenblatt

Punxsutawney Area High School

Class Of 2027

WR, DB

Jersey #10

HT/WT 5’8ft, 150LB

21.8 Yards per catch, LNG 52 Yards, 4 TDS

Other sports Basketball

Twitter/X     @Greenie_10


Coach Says: Jaden is a returning 2-way starter at WR and Corner. He is one of our most experienced returning varsity players. He was second in interceptions from a year ago and 4th in receiving yards. We expect Jaden to be a key piece of our offense and return game. We are excited for him to take the next step with the departure of our leading receivers. We are excited for what he can bring in all three phases of the game.
